How does chiropractic care work?

Chiropractic care is a form of alternative medicine that focuses on diagnosing and treating mechanical disorders of the musculoskeletal system, especially the spine. The primary chiropractic technique involves manual therapy, including manipulation of the spine, other joints, and soft tissues; sometimes, it includes exercises and health and lifestyle counselling. Its foundation is a mix of philosophy and science. The majority of chiropractic patients are satisfied with their care, although some may experience mild side effects such as pain or discomfort in the hours or days following treatment.

Are there any risks associated with chiropractic care?

Yes, there are risks associated with chiropractic care, but they are generally minor and temporary. The most common side effects include soreness, stiffness, and aching in the treated area. These effects are usually mild and resolve independently within a few days. More serious side effects are rare but can include herniated discs, spinal cord injury, and stroke. When performed by a qualified practitioner, the risks of chiropractic care are incredibly minimal.
